- Summary
- The Expo Executive Producer is a senior production leadership role responsible for defining, integrating, and executing the full expo experience within large, complex event programs.
- Essential Duties & Responsibilities
- + Own the end-to-end vision, strategy, and execution of the expo hall experience across large-scale programs + Translate client business objectives into a cohesive exhibitor and attendee experience, integrating the needs of both the client, sponsors and other critical stakeholders + Serve as the central integration point aligning all cross-functional and partner teams—Production, Creative, Technical, Exhibitor Services, and Operations—to deliver a cohesive, enterprise-level solution + Establish and drive KPIs related to exhibitor satisfaction, operational performance, financial performance and service delivery + Lead complex, multi-workstream production environments across expo operations, content, and logistics + Oversee the full event lifecycle from concept through execution and post-event reconciliation + Lead financial reconciliation and performance reporting + Coordinate with Technical Directors, Line Producers, and other leaders to ensure integrated execution + Set performance expectations, drive accountability, and mentor future leaders •Education & Experience•+ 10+ years of experience in event production, expo management, or experiential programms + Bachelor's degree preferred, High School Diploma or Equivalent with relevant work experience required + Background in agency, communications company or production company leadership + Proven success leading large-scale, complex production environments within enterprise or matrixed organizational settings, including experience working across multiple business units, agency partners, or integrated delivery models + Demonstrated experience integrating multiple internal teams + Strong financial acumen with experience managing multi-million-dollar budgets, including demonstrated ability to assess scope and budget feasibility early in the production process, recognizing risk before commitments are made and guiding stakeholders toward viable solutions + Experience leveraging KPIs and performance metrics + Executive presence and strong decision-making capability + Ability to build trust and alignment across diverse stakeholders—clients, account leaders, creative teams, and production partners—bringing a unifying rather than directive leadership approach + Strong analytical approach + Exceptional communication skills and high emotional intelligence + Ability to lead through complexity •Travel Requirements•Travel 25% to 50% •What We Offer•The Freeman Company provides benefits that aim to empower our people and their families to thrive mentally, physically, and financially.
